A detailed history of America's involvement in Vietnam from 1945 to 2010, covering political decisions, military actions, and long-term consequences.

About This Book

This book examines the long arc of U.S. engagement in Vietnam, beginning with the end of World War II and extending through the early twenty-first century.

It explores the political, military, and social dimensions of the conflict and its lasting consequences for both nations.

The authors provide a balanced account that situates the Vietnam War within broader Cold War dynamics and American foreign policy.
